117.info
人生若只如初见

什么是serverlet

Servlet是Java语言编写的一种服务器端程序。它运行在Web服务器上,用于处理来自客户端的请求并生成响应。Servlet通常用于开发动态网页和Web应用程序。

Servlet是基于Java Servlet技术的程序,它通过HTTP协议与客户端通信。当客户端发送一个HTTP请求时,Web服务器会将请求转发给适当的Servlet进行处理。Servlet可以读取请求参数、获取请求头信息、执行业务逻辑处理,并生成响应内容发送给客户端。

Servlet通常用于生成动态网页,它可以根据客户端请求的不同,动态生成页面内容并返回给客户端。Servlet也可以用于处理表单提交、身份验证、数据库访问等任务。通过使用Servlet,开发者可以以Java语言编写代码,实现服务器端的各种功能。

Servlet的运行环境是Servlet容器,例如Tomcat、Jetty等。Servlet容器负责管理Servlet的生命周期、处理并发请求、提供Servlet API等功能。

总结起来,Servlet是一种服务器端程序,它运行在Web服务器上,用于处理来自客户端的请求并生成响应。通过使用Servlet,可以实现动态网页生成、表单处理、身份验证等功能。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fedceAzsLCQdeB10.html

推荐文章

  • serverlet的作用有哪些

    Servlet的作用有以下几点: 接收和处理客户端的请求:Servlet充当了Web服务器和客户端之间的中间层,负责接收和处理客户端的请求。通过Servlet,可以接收来自浏览...

  • Serverlet简介及理解

    Servlet是一种Java编写的服务器端程序,用于处理客户端的请求并生成响应。它是运行在Web服务器上的Java类,可以接收HTTP请求并返回HTML、XML、JSON等格式的响应。...

  • serverlet指的是什么意思

    Servlet是一种Java程序,运行在服务器上,用于接收和响应来自客户端的请求。Servlet常用于构建Web应用程序,可以处理用户请求、生成动态内容、与数据库进行交互等...

  • 到底什么是serverlet

    Servlet(Servlet)是Java编程语言用于扩展服务器功能的组件。尽管Servlet可以以多种方式实现,但在Web容器中,Servlet通常指的是基于Java技术的服务器端组件。<...

  • Process.start指定为UseShellExecute=false的问题

    当使用Process.Start方法时,可以通过将UseShellExecute属性设置为false来控制是否使用操作系统的Shell执行程序。当UseShellExecute设置为false时,Process.Star...

  • getRequest().getParameter与request.getParameter的区别

    getRequest().getParameter()和request.getParameter()是两种获取请求参数的方法,它们的区别如下: 对象类型不同:getRequest().getParameter()是从ServletRequ...

  • list index out of bounds( )的错误

    "list index out of bounds"错误表示你正在尝试访问列表中不存在的索引位置。这通常发生在以下情况下: 你正在尝试访问一个负数的索引值。列表的索引是从0开始的...

  • setsockopt函数的错误 100038

    错误码 100038 是无效参数错误,这可能是因为你传递给 setsockopt 函数的参数不正确。setsockopt 用于设置套接字选项,参数包括套接字描述符、选项级别、选项名称...